Technical datasheet

FASCAT® 4102

Supplied byPMC Group- Last Updated on Oct 16, 2025

FASCAT® 4102 by PMC Group is a catalyst. It is a pale yellow, hydrolytically stable butyltin tris-2-ethylhexanoate. It primarily catalyzes polycondensation and esterification reactions at temperatures between 80-150°C.
  • It is neutral, non-corrosive, easy to handle and readily disperses in reaction mixtures.
  • It is known to significantly shorten esterification cycle times compared to uncatalyzed systems.
  • It can minimize side reactions such as ether formation from polyhydric alcohols.
  • It is designed to synthesize saturated polyester resins for powder coatings and coil coatings.
  • FASCAT® 4102 can also be used in the production of aromatic polyester polyols for flexible and rigid PU foam applications.
